![]() | The Wildflower Pony (1996) (The second book in the Alice Brown's Pony series) A novel by Anne Eliot Crompton |
In the middle of a freak spring snowstorm, Alice Brown's pony, Lucky, surprises her by giving birth to a foal. Now Alice has two ponies -- and pretty soon two mouths to feed. Alice can't tell her dad about the foal -- he didn't want her to have even one pony -- so she'll have to keep Sugar hidden at her friend Jinny's place. That's no problem, but getting money for hay is. How can Alice ever afford it?
Then she hears about the Fourth of July contest. The best animal act will be awarded $500. With two adorable ponies and lots of practice Alice is sure she can win. But if she doesn't win, will she still be able to keep the foal?
